Hirofumi Sudo is a leading researcher in pharmaceutical robotics and the safe handling of hazardous drugs, with a primary focus on the automation of injectable anticancer drug compounding. His major contribution lies in the rigorous clinical evaluation of the APOTECAchemo compounding robot, demonstrating its accuracy, safety, and feasibility within a Japanese hospital setting. His seminal 2017 study, which has garnered 49 citations, provided critical evidence that robotic systems can significantly reduce human exposure to cytotoxic agents while maintaining high precision in drug preparation. This work directly addresses the occupational hazards faced by pharmacy technicians and nurses, positioning Sudo as a key figure in the transition toward automated, safer pharmacy practices. By validating the performance of APOTECAchemo, he has helped pave the way for broader adoption of robotics in hospital pharmacies, ultimately improving both staff safety and patient care quality.
